Cory may be able to answer this question better than I by actually using the phones but I'm going to give my input anyway b/c I'm taking a Data Networking and Telecommunications class and we just went over a chapter on wireless LANs (WLANs) and issues with them and different frequencies, etc.
I guess you know that wireless operates in both 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z ranges. Most wireless now uses the standards for 802.11 b and g, which both use the 2.4 GHz bands and they use 3 nonoverlapping channels, 1, 6, and 11. 802.11a uses 5 GHz but is rarely used and a new one that will be 802.11n standard will be able to use both ranges at 2.4 and 5 GHz, although I don't believe it is currently in use. So for now, you can probably use that 5 GHz phone but if you upgrade standards for WiFi later on, my guess is that it may then interfere depending on the channels you use for each. There are also some massive improvements in separating two different signals using 802.11n so it may not be a problem after all. Just my pilthy 2 cents. LOL
